Sustainability
Growing hemp is much less harmful to the environment than comparable materials, such as cotton. This is because hemp takes fewer nutrients from the soil, keeping soil quality stable, it requires less water, and requires fewer pesticides. In addition, clothing made from hemp usually lasts longer because the fibers are stiffer.
